Choose from either of our two convenient times for our daily 45-mile round trip tour. We begin our journey at the Klamath estuary called "Rek-woy", the Yurok name for "Where the fresh water meets the Pacific Ocean". The Jet Boat Tour is the 2 hour tour, that takes you to the estuary and then up 22 miles up the River. The estuary tour is a 1 hour tour that takes around the estuary. As your Captain turns the boat upriver and powers up the twin jets, sit back, relax and view nature in it's most primitive form as it unfolds before you! Our experienced captains provide a fully narrated river trip with plenty of stops to photograph spectacular vistas and wildlife. Bears are often seen feeding along the banks of the river on berries, fish and grubs. Ospreys return in April to their nesting area of the Klamath River from as far south as Brazil. Klamath mornings and evenings are typically cool or overcast near the coast, so dress yourself in plenty of layers. As you travel upriver, be prepared to shed some clothing as the day heats up. We recommend hats and sunglasses.
